| Christina Georgina Rossetti (C.G. Rossetti) |
Full Name: Christina Georgina Rossetti
Born: 5 December 1830, London, England
Died: 29 December 1894, London, England
Famous As: English poet
Known For: Simple yet deep poems, devotional and children’s poetry
Family: Her brother Dante Gabriel Rossetti was a famous poet and painter.
Major Works:
The Goblin Market, Remember, The Rainbow (children’s poem), In the Bleak Midwinter (Christmas poem)
Christina Georgina Rossetti was a famous English poet. She was born on 5th December 1830 in London. She wrote simple but beautiful poems for children and adults. Her poems often describe nature, love, and faith. Some of her famous works are The Goblin Market, Remember, and The Rainbow. She died on 29th December 1894 in London.

Lesson - 3
The Rainbow
By Christina Georgina Rossetti
Boats sail on the rivers,
And ships sail on the seas;
But clouds that sail across the sky
Are prettier far than these.
There are bridges on the rivers,
As pretty as you please;
But the bow that bridges heaven,
And overtops the trees,
And builds a road from earth to sky,
Is prettier far than these.
